About Bill

Bill M. Wade, who joined Pietrangelo Cook PLC as an Associate Attorney in 2001, was born in Biloxi, Mississippi in 1974. He was admitted to the Tennessee Bar in 2000, and admitted to the Arkansas Bar in 2001.

He graduated magna cum laude from the University of Notre Dame in South Bend, Ind., with a Bachelor of Arts in Anthropology and History in 1997. Bill spent his junior year abroad, studying at University College Dublin, Ireland.

Bill attained his Juris Doctor degree from Vanderbilt University in 2000. While at Vanderbilt, he was a member of the World Champion Moot Court Team, which won the 8th Annual Manfred Lachs International Moot Court Championship. He argued the final round before the International Court of Justice at The Hague, The Netherlands.

His practice areas include general business and commercial litigation.

Bill's interests include playing the guitar and elk hunting. Bill and his wife, Rachel, were married November 15, 2003 and live in Midtown.
